DEFENCE ACT 1903 - SECT 106

Failure to provide sample

  (1)   A defence member or defence civilian commits an offence if:

  (a)   an authorised person has required the defence member or defence civilian under section   94 to provide a sample; and

  (b)   the defence member or defence civilian refuses or fails to provide the sample.

Penalty :   Imprisonment for 6 months.

  (2)   In paragraph   ( 1)(a), strict liability applies to the physical element of circumstance, that the requirement is under section   94.

Note:   For strict liability , see section   6.1 of the Criminal Code .
